THE Correctional Service has secured K12.4 million for the re-development of the Boram state-of-the-art prison facility. The funding news came at a time when 17 inmates in a mass break-out on July 17 are still at large while one of them has been shot dead by authorities. Correctional Service Minister Tony Aimo asked them to voluntarily surrender and made the funding announcement during his Independence Day message during his visit to the jail last week Mr Aimo said the current jail blocks were situated in the planned extension for the Boram Airport to international status. The Boram jail blocks that is opposite the Wewak Golf Course will both be relocated as the National Government and Transport and Civil Aviation develop the extension of the Boram Airport. Mr Aimo said work on the new facility would begin as of next year. The minister revealed this during his visit to the Boram jail last week where he met inmates and presented a keyboard to the prisoner’s Christian outreach programme, a television set and DVD player.
